Mastering Azure DevOps: Key Features & Benefits
Azure DevOps has become an essential platform for modern software development, enabling teams to collaborate efficiently, automate workflows, and deliver high-quality applications. It provides a complete suite of tools for continuous integration, continuous delivery (CI/CD), and agile project management. Whether you’re a startup or a large enterprise, Azure DevOps offers a scalable and secure environment for managing the entire software development lifecycle. In this article, we will explore the key features and benefits of Azure DevOps and why it is a preferred choice for DevOps professionals.
Key Features of Azure DevOps
1. Azure Repos (Version Control)
Azure Repos provides version control with Git and Team Foundation Version Control (TFVC), allowing developers to manage code efficiently. It supports branching strategies, pull requests, and code reviews, helping teams collaborate seamlessly and track changes in their projects.
2. Azure Pipelines (CI/CD Automation)
Azure Pipelines automate software build, testing, and deployment processes. It supports multi-platform builds for Windows, Linux, and macOS and integrates with tools like GitHub, Docker, and Kubernetes. With built-in CI/CD automation, teams can deploy faster while maintaining high quality.
3. Azure Boards (Agile Project Management)
Azure Boards is a powerful tool for tracking work items, sprint planning, and reporting. It supports Agile, Scrum, and Kanban methodologies, allowing teams to manage projects effectively and track progress in real-time.
4. Azure Test Plans (Testing & Quality Assurance)
Quality assurance is crucial in software development. Azure Test Plans provides both manual and automated testing capabilities, ensuring that applications meet performance and security standards before deployment.
5. Azure Artifacts (Package Management)
Azure Artifacts allows teams to create, host, and share Maven, npm, NuGet, and Python packages securely. This simplifies dependency management and ensures that development teams always use the latest and most secure versions of their software packages.
Benefits of Using Azure DevOps
1. Complete DevOps Solution
Azure DevOps offers an end-to-end DevOps solution, integrating all aspects of the development process—coding, building, testing, and deployment—within a single platform. This reduces the need for multiple third-party tools, leading to better efficiency.
2. Scalability and Flexibility
Azure DevOps is designed to scale with your business needs. Whether you are a small team or a large enterprise, you can leverage its cloud-based infrastructure to manage complex projects with ease. It also supports third-party integrations, providing flexibility in development workflows. Microsoft Azure DevOps Training
3. Enhanced Security & Compliance
Security is a major concern for organizations adopting DevOps. Azure DevOps includes built-in security measures such as access control, policy enforcement, and compliance tracking, ensuring that sensitive data remains protected.
4. Improved Productivity and Collaboration
By automating repetitive tasks and providing real-time collaboration tools, Azure DevOps boosts team productivity. Features like pull requests, code reviews, and automated testing help developers focus on delivering high-quality software instead of managing infrastructure manually.
5. Seamless Cloud Integration
Azure DevOps integrates smoothly with Microsoft Azure, allowing for quick and seamless application deployments. It also supports hybrid and multi-cloud environments, giving organizations the flexibility to deploy their applications where they are most needed.
Conclusion
Azure DevOps is a powerful and comprehensive platform that enables teams to streamline software development, improve collaboration, and enhance efficiency in CI/CD workflows. With its rich set of features, scalability, and security, it provides everything an organization needs to implement DevOps successfully. Whether you are new to DevOps or looking to optimize your existing processes, Azure DevOps can help you achieve faster, more reliable, and secure software delivery.
Visualpath is the Leading and Best Software Online Training Institute in Hyderabad.
For More Information about Azure DevOps Training in India
Contact Call/WhatsApp: +91-7032290546
Visit: https://www.visualpath.in/online-azure-devops-Training.html
Comments on “Azure DevOps Training in Chennai | Visualpath”